Profile image

SP Label Converter

108k PlanariaLab  1.3 years ago

new version->link<-

Software to convert image and video files so that they can be displayed with SP text labels.
This program is inspired by the work of its predecessors, but improves the format of the labels to reduce waste, adds lightweight options, support for video files, and other features that I want.

Respect for forerunner

hpgbproductions
IzzyIA

.

1
The output will be an xml file of the subassembly.
Put it in SimplePlanes/SubAssemblies and call it from the build screen.

Export example

2
link
link2
The first link is made larger for load testing.
Please be careful when using this program in your work, especially for color, as the load is very heavy.

3
link
The load within the flight was kept to an acceptable level, but using long videos will stretch the loading time considerably.
Short and low quality items such as GIF videos may be usable.
(Gif import is not supported, so please convert to mp4 or avi with other software in advance.)
.

download link

The opencv library is required to run the source code. Please install it beforehand. (It is probably not necessary in case of exe.)
There may be a warning of unknown origin issued by the defender at startup.
I don't recall putting in any malicious code, so I don't see any problem with running it as is.
if you're worried, please run the source code (SPLC.py) from the Python environment.
Also, since exe was created by Pyinstaller, it takes a little time to start up.

The UI translation may not be correct...
There is a section in the source code that summarizes the text used for the UI, so please refer to that section and modify as necessary.

create with Python3.9.2 OpenCV 4.6.0

  • Log in to leave a comment
  • Profile image
    92 luoxue

    @PlanariaLab I think I understand. Thank you for your answer.

    3 months ago
  • Profile image

    @luoxue
    Both character spacing and line spacing refer to "spacing" items.
    The output xml is fully compatible with the xml of the SubAssembly.
    Put the output xml into %APPDATA%\LocalLow\Jundroo\SimplePlanes\SubAssemblies and load it from SubAssemblies in the game.
    (If you don't know what APPDATA is, look it up yourself, it's essential knowledge if you want to play games on your pc.)

    3 months ago
  • Profile image
    92 luoxue

    @PlanariaLab I understand a little bit, where does the newly generated file start to copy the contents of the build tag pattern?And how to set the line spacing?

    3 months ago
  • Profile image

    @luoxue
    Software does not start from exe -> Check your antivirus software, build a python environment and start from py file, or give up using it.
    .
    The software is launched but you don't know how to use it -> Select the image file from the top browse, change the settings if necessary, and press run in the lower right corner. Anything more than that cannot be explained with my language skills.

    3 months ago
  • Profile image
    92 luoxue

    I really can't use it. Can you teach me?

    3 months ago
  • Profile image

    @Roomba
    Select en from the radio buttons in the lower right corner of the screen

    11 months ago
  • Profile image
    15 Roomba

    English translation please

    11 months ago
  • Profile image
    18.0k AtlasSP

    can i run this using a virtual machine e.g. VMware?

    one year ago
  • Profile image
    48.1k Sm10684

    Nice!

    1.3 years ago
  • Profile image

    so good!!!!!!!!
    but,how to use...?

    1.3 years ago
  • Profile image
    2,677 ongatame

    Innovation.

    1.3 years ago
  • Profile image
    66.7k SnoWFLakE0s

    いいですね~

    +1 1.3 years ago
  • Profile image
    23.1k FoxG

    I think it will be useful when making the eyes.

    1.3 years ago
  • Profile image

    Woah

    +2 1.3 years ago